Man Utd wanted draw at Man City says Lampard

Manchester United went to the Etihad Stadium in search of a draw with Manchester City, according to Frank Lampard.

Jose Mourinho's Red Devils conjured only a few shots on goal in the eventual 0-0 draw suggesting to former City midfielder Lampard that they set themselves up simply to gain a point from the Manchester derby.

He told Sky Sports: "I'm slightly surprised. We did feel that he (Mourinho) was going to defend deep. They definitely played for that.

"They didn't overcommit players at any stage. I think Martial played like a left-back at times.

"I give real credit to the midfield - not to Fellaini for what happened at the end - Michael Carrick and Ander Herrera worked their socks off. The back four moved from side to side.

"When you look at the table, maybe you see why they played for it, as the top four is in their hands still.

"I don't think Mourinho wanted to go toe-to-toe with Manchester City tonight. He looked at the bigger picture. They got the result they wanted, and they're happy in the dressing room, for sure."
